技术风口 Spring Al+ChatGPT Java接入AI大模型

75 阅读4分钟

read-normal-img

download ::quangneng上图水印

技术风口:Spring AI + ChatGPT Java 接入 AI 大模型的未来发展

在人工智能领域,AI大模型的快速发展正在引领技术创新的风潮。作为其中的重要一环,Spring框架与ChatGPT的结合展示了前景广阔的应用潜力。本文将探讨Spring AI与ChatGPT在Java环境中的集成如何塑造未来的技术趋势,以及这一发展对开发者和企业的影响。

1. AI大模型的崛起

AI大模型,如OpenAI的ChatGPT,凭借其在自然语言处理(NLP)中的卓越表现,正在成为智能应用的核心。这些模型通过海量的数据和复杂的算法训练,具备了强大的语言理解和生成能力,使得它们能够在各种场景下提供高质量的智能交互。

2. Spring框架的优势

Spring是一个广泛使用的Java框架,它提供了强大的企业级功能,包括依赖注入、面向切面编程、数据访问等。Spring Boot的出现进一步简化了应用的开发和部署,使得开发者能够更高效地构建和维护Java应用。

3. Spring AI 与 ChatGPT 的结合

将Spring框架与ChatGPT集成,主要涉及以下几个方面:

  • API集成:利用Spring的RESTful API能力,可以轻松地将ChatGPT接入到Java应用中。Spring Boot的简洁配置和自动化功能使得与ChatGPT的交互变得更加便捷。
  • 数据管理:Spring Data可以处理从ChatGPT生成的数据,进行存储、检索和分析。这为开发者提供了强大的数据管理工具,支持高效的数据操作。
  • 安全性:Spring Security可以确保与ChatGPT交互的数据传输的安全性,防止潜在的安全漏洞和数据泄露。

4. 未来发展趋势

  • 智能客服和虚拟助手:结合ChatGPT的自然语言处理能力,企业可以构建更加智能化的客服系统和虚拟助手,这些系统能够提供24/7的客户支持,处理各种复杂的查询和请求。
  • 个性化用户体验:通过对用户数据的分析和理解,ChatGPT可以提供个性化的推荐和内容,增强用户体验。例如,电商平台可以利用ChatGPT来提供个性化的购物建议。
  • 企业自动化:集成AI大模型可以帮助企业自动化许多重复性任务,例如文档生成、数据分析和报告撰写,从而提升工作效率和减少人为错误。
  • 教育和培训:在教育领域,结合ChatGPT的应用可以提供智能化的教学辅导和培训支持,帮助学生更好地理解复杂概念和完成作业。
  • 跨平台集成:未来,Spring AI与ChatGPT的结合将不再局限于Java环境,可能会扩展到其他技术栈和平台,实现跨平台的智能服务和应用集成。

5. 挑战与机遇

  • 技术挑战:尽管Spring与ChatGPT的结合带来了诸多优势,但在实际应用中,仍然面临如性能优化、数据隐私保护和模型更新等技术挑战。
  • 伦理和法规:随着AI技术的深入应用,如何处理数据隐私、伦理问题以及遵守相关法规成为一个重要课题。企业需要制定相应的策略和措施,确保合规性。
  • 创新机遇:技术的快速发展为企业和开发者提供了广阔的创新空间。利用AI大模型与Spring框架的结合,能够探索出许多新的应用场景和商业模式。

结论

Spring AI与ChatGPT的集成代表了技术发展的前沿方向,为Java开发者和企业带来了巨大的机遇。未来,随着技术的不断进步,这种结合将推动智能应用的普及和创新,改变我们与技术互动的方式。通过不断探索和实践,开发者可以在这个充满活力的领域中开辟新的前景,打造更加智能和高效的解决方案。